[PATCH RFC 09/16] dt-bindings: bus: aspeed: Require syscon for AST2600 AHB controller

The AST2600's ACRY (eliptic curve and RSA crypto engine) requires access
to configuration exposed by the AHB controller. The devicetree already
describes the AHB controller node as a syscon, so require this in the
binding to satisfy the ACRY relationship.
